The Railway Recruitment Board has released the candidates’ response sheet for RRB NTPC 2022 CBT 2 for pay level 4 and 6 in online mode. Candidates who took NTPC CBT 2 exam can download the response sheet and answer key till May 18, 2022 (11.55 PM).

To download the RRB NTPC CBT 2 response sheet, candidates should log in with their login credentials such as registration number and date of birth.

Steps to download the RRB NTPC CBT 2 Response sheet 2022
Step 1: Go to respective official RRB regional websites
Step 2: Click the “ Link for viewing question paper” on the home page
Step 3: On the next tab login page will be open
Step 4: Enter candidate registration number and date of birth and click “login” button.
Step 5: Click the “candidate response” tab.
Step 6: Check the RRB NTPC CBT 2 response sheet.
Step 7: Save and print the RRB NTPC CBT 2 response sheet for your reference.
The RRB NTPC CBT 2 exam 2022 was conducted for pay levels 4 and 6 from May 9 to 10, 2022 at various exam centres across the country. In continuation, the RRB has released the NTPC CBT 2 response sheet for candidates' purposes.
Candidates can check and download the RRB NTPC CBT 2 response sheet within the specified time period only.
